Personal data protection
The purpose of processing personal data is to use it for the performance of the consumer contract, which the seller concludes with the buyer by placing an order in this online shop. This Consumer Agreement is also the legal basis for the processing of the buyer's personal data. The provision of the buyer's personal data is a contractual requirement that is necessary for the conclusion of the contract. The provision of personal data is a condition for purchase in the seller's e-shop. Failure to provide all the required personal information to the seller may result in the purchase agreement not being concluded.
In processing personal data, the seller shall proceed in accordance with Act no. 18/2018 on the protection of personal data and processes only personal data necessary for the conclusion of a consumer contract.
The seller processes the buyer's regular personal data.
The buyer's personal data are stored in the seller's information system for ten years.
The buyer has the right and the possibility to update personal data in the online mode on the website of the online store, in the customer section, after login, or using the different forms (by e-mail, in writing).
For the consumer contract, personal data may be provided to third parties - courier delivery companies and the company that processes accounting documents.
The buyer's personal information is not disclosed.
The Seller may provide customer's personal information (to an extent: email address) to company Heureka Shopping s.r.o., solely for the "Verified by Customer" program, to obtain feedback from the buyer in connection with the purchase made in the seller's e-shop.
The buyer has the right to obtain confirmation from the seller what personal data of the buyer is processed in the seller's e-shop. The buyer has the right to gain access to such data as well as the purpose for which it is processed, what categories of data are processed, to whom personal data are provided, how long personal data is stored, whether there exists automated individual decision making, including profiling.
The first provision of the above personal information to the buyer is free of charge. Repeated provision of personal data requested by the buyer will be charged for an administrative fee of € 5.
The buyer may require the seller to correct or complete incomplete personal data concerning the buyer. The buyer may request the deletion of his data or a restriction on the processing of such data. The buyer may also object to the processing of personal data.
The processing of personal data by the buyer is also necessary for archiving (to fulfill the obligation of the seller based on the legislation of the Slovak Republic, for example, keeping the accounting documents for ten years). If the buyer requests the deletion of personal data processed in connection with the purchase contract, his application may be rejected.
The buyer has the right to have the seller restrict the processing of his personal data if the buyer disputes the correctness of the personal data during the period allowing the seller to verify the accuracy of the personal data.
The buyer has the right to obtain personal data concerning him which he has provided to the seller in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format. The buyer has the right to transfer this personal data to another operator, if technically possible.
The buyer has the right to object if his data are processed for direct marketing purposes. He may also object if his data are processed for the legitimate interest of the seller.
If the buyer suspects that his personal data are being processed illegally, he may file a complaint to the Office for Personal Data Protection to initiate the personal data protection proceedings.
The above information about the processing of personal data also applies to pre-contractual relationships (i.e., registration in an e-shop for future purchase or, for example, request a demand, quotation or information about the seller's goods and services).
